Understanding Mortgage Refinancing

What Does Refinancing Mean?

Refinancing replaces your existing mortgage with a new one, ideally at a lower interest rate or with better terms. This can reduce your monthly payments, shorten your loan term, or free up cash through a cash-out refinance.

Common Reasons People Refinance

Homeowners refinance to:

  • Lower monthly payments

  • Switch from variable to fixed rates

  • Consolidate debt

  • Tap into home equity

Factors Affecting Mortgage Refinance Rates in 2026

Inflation and Interest Rate Policies

In early 2026, central banks signaled moderate rate cuts following years of inflation control. As a result, average refinance rates are trending between 5.4% and 6.2%, depending on lender and loan type.

Credit Score and Debt-to-Income Ratio

A credit score above 740 typically qualifies for the best rates. Keep your debt-to-income ratio below 43% for better approval chances.

Loan-to-Value (LTV) Ratio and Property Equity

The more equity you have, the lower your refinance rate. Lenders prefer an LTV below 80%, showing you own a significant portion of your home.

Fixed vs Adjustable Refinance Rates in 2026

Which One’s Better in the Current Economy?

If you prefer stability, fixed rates are your best bet. They protect you from future rate hikes. However, adjustable rates (ARMs) may start lower—ideal if you plan to sell your home within a few years.

Pros and Cons of Both Options

TypeProsConsFixedPredictable paymentsHigher initial ratesARMLower intro ratesRisk of future increase

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Refinancing

  1. Ignoring closing costs – They can eat into your savings.

  2. Focusing only on rate, not APR – APR includes fees and gives a truer cost picture.

  3. Refinancing too often – Frequent refinancing resets your loan term and adds costs.


Expert Tips to Maximize Savings

  • Negotiate lender fees. Many waive application or origination costs if you ask.

  • Refinance early. Don’t wait for “perfect” rates—markets are unpredictable.

  • Consider a shorter term. A 15-year refinance often saves more long-term despite slightly higher monthly payments.
